This small series consists of some small cleanups and simplifications
of the QUICC engine driver, and introduces a new DT binding that makes
it much easier to support other variants of the QUICC engine IP block
that appears in the wild: There's no reason to expect in general that
the number of valid SNUMs uniquely determines the set of such, so it's
better to simply let the device tree specify the values (and,
implicitly via the array length, also the count).

v3:
- Move example from commit log into binding document (adapting to
  MPC8360 which the existing example pertains to).
- Add more review tags.
- Fix minor style issue.

v2:
- Address comments from Christophe Leroy
- Add his Reviewed-by to 1/6 and 3/6
- Split DT binding update to separate patch as per
  Documentation/devicetree/bindings/submitting-patches.txt

Rasmus Villemoes (6):
  soc/fsl/qe: qe.c: drop useless static qualifier
  soc/fsl/qe: qe.c: reduce static memory footprint by 1.7K
  soc/fsl/qe: qe.c: introduce qe_get_device_node helper
  dt-bindings: soc/fsl: qe: document new fsl,qe-snums binding
  soc/fsl/qe: qe.c: support fsl,qe-snums property
  soc/fsl/qe: qe.c: fold qe_get_num_of_snums into qe_snums_init

 .../devicetree/bindings/soc/fsl/cpm_qe/qe.txt |  13 +-
 drivers/soc/fsl/qe/qe.c                       | 163 +++++++-----------
 2 files changed, 77 insertions(+), 99 deletions(-)
